Program overview. Instruction in the program is rooted in the investigation of painting as a unique genre with its own complex syntax and history. Within this setting, the program encourages diversity of practice and interpretation, innovation, and experimentation. Approximately twenty-one students are admitted each year.
Graphic Design (MFA) Program overview. The graphic design program focuses on the development of a cohesive, investigative body of work, also known as the student’s thesis.
